name: Decrypt Release Secrets
description: Decrypts age-sealed Burrow release secrets and exports CI paths/env.
inputs:
root:
description: Repository root
required: false
default: .
runs:
using: composite
steps:
- shell: bash
run: |
set -euo pipefail
ROOT_INPUT='${{ inputs.root }}'
ROOT="$(cd "$ROOT_INPUT" && pwd)"
resolve_nix_bin() {
local candidate
for candidate in \
"${NIX_BIN:-}" \
"$(command -v nix 2>/dev/null || true)" \
/nix/var/nix/profiles/default/bin/nix \
"${HOME:-}/.nix-profile/bin/nix" \
"${HOME:-}/.local/state/nix/profile/bin/nix" \
/Users/runner/.nix-profile/bin/nix \
/Users/runner/.local/state/nix/profile/bin/nix \
/home/runner/.nix-profile/bin/nix \
/home/runner/.local/state/nix/profile/bin/nix \
; do
if [[ -n "$candidate" && -x "$candidate" ]]; then
printf '%s\n' "$candidate"
return 0
fi
done
return 1
}
resolve_decrypt_tool() {
local candidate
for candidate in \
"${AGE_BIN:-}" \
"$(command -v age 2>/dev/null || true)" \
/opt/homebrew/bin/age \
/usr/local/bin/age \
/usr/bin/age \
/run/current-system/sw/bin/age \
/etc/profiles/per-user/runner/bin/age \
"${HOME:-}/.nix-profile/bin/age" \
"${HOME:-}/.local/state/nix/profile/bin/age" \
/Users/runner/.nix-profile/bin/age \
/Users/runner/.local/state/nix/profile/bin/age \
/home/runner/.nix-profile/bin/age \
/home/runner/.local/state/nix/profile/bin/age \
; do
if [[ -n "$candidate" && -x "$candidate" ]]; then
printf 'age:%s\n' "$candidate"
return 0
fi
done
for candidate in \
"${AGENIX_BIN:-}" \
"$(command -v agenix 2>/dev/null || true)" \
; do
if [[ -n "$candidate" && -x "$candidate" ]]; then
printf 'agenix:%s\n' "$candidate"
return 0
fi
done
local nix_bin
nix_bin="$(resolve_nix_bin || true)"
if [[ -n "$nix_bin" ]]; then
local built
built="$("$nix_bin" --extra-experimental-features 'nix-command flakes' build --no-link "$ROOT#age" --print-out-paths 2>/dev/null | tail -n 1 || true)"
if [[ -n "$built" && -x "$built/bin/age" ]]; then
printf 'age:%s\n' "$built/bin/age"
return 0
fi
built="$("$nix_bin" --extra-experimental-features 'nix-command flakes' build --no-link "$ROOT#agenix" --print-out-paths 2>/dev/null | tail -n 1 || true)"
if [[ -n "$built" && -x "$built/bin/agenix" ]]; then
printf 'agenix:%s\n' "$built/bin/agenix"
return 0
fi
fi
echo "::error ::age or agenix is required to decrypt release secrets but neither is available." >&2
exit 1
}
decrypt_tool="$(resolve_decrypt_tool)"
decrypt_kind="${decrypt_tool%%:*}"
decrypt_bin="${decrypt_tool#*:}"
KEY="${AGE_IDENTITY_PATH:-}"
if [[ -z "$KEY" || ! -s "$KEY" ]]; then
echo "::error ::Missing age identity. Run Scripts/resolve-age-identity.sh before this action." >&2
exit 1
fi
decrypt_age_file() {
local file_path="$1"
if [[ "$decrypt_kind" == "agenix" ]]; then
local agenix_path="$file_path"
if [[ "$file_path" == "$ROOT/"* ]]; then
agenix_path="${file_path#"$ROOT"/}"
fi
(cd "$ROOT" && "$decrypt_bin" --identity "$KEY" --decrypt "$agenix_path")
else
"$decrypt_bin" --decrypt -i "$KEY" "$file_path"
fi
}
